Ed Charney is a Western Pennsylvania native; his early years were spent exploring the dramatic foothills of the Allegheny mountains and the farming communities scattered amongst them. He attended Indiana University of Pennsylvania for a Bachelors degree with a focus on Metallry, Painting, and Art History. H attended Edinboro University of Pennsylvania for a Master's degree in Painting and Sculpture. His journey into the academic world began after that. He taught at several different locations including EUP, PSU/Behrend college, Towson State, Wartburg College, and Wittenberg University. Prior to a full-time teaching assignment, he worked in several unrelated fields such as Trackman for Penn Central RR, Carpenter, Retail Bakery Manager, Gallery Director, among others.
Charney is painting full-time in his farmhouse in the rural part of Western Ohio. His landscape painting history has been influenced by the various locations that he taught. Pennsylvania, Maryland, Iowa, and Ohio have had an impact on his art.Each region inspired paintings that reflect his attention to the elements that create the unique character of the place. Mr. Charney's work can be seen in public and private collections around the Midwest.
